/*
 * File: news.c
 * Name: Extended News (v3.03)
 * Author: John 'Noplex' Bellone (jbellone@comcast.net)
 * Terms:
 * If this file is to be re-disributed; you must send an email
 * to the author. All headers above the #include calls must be
 * kept intact. All license requirements must be met. License
 * can be found in the included license.txt document or on the
 * website.
 * Description:
 * This is Crimson Blade's extended news module. It allows for news
 * cataglories to be created; each having it's own different filesystem
 * where news can be posted. It also allows for each to be specified a
 * specific path and filename where the news-textdump of HTML can be
 * sent to.
 * The news commands are tied directly into the command interpreter; so
 * news-types are instantaniously added; removed; and edited.
 */
